Gå til hovedinnhold

Behandling

Språkmodeller

Språkmodeller er avanserte AI-systemer som kan forstå, tolke og generere menneskelig språk. Disse modellene trenes på enorme tekstdatabaser og lærer mønstre, ordkombinasjoner, setningsstrukturer og til og med nyanser i forskjellige språk og språkbruk. Kjernen i mange moderne språkmodeller er transformer-arkitekturen, som bruker selvoppmerksomhetsmekanismer for å avgjøre hvilke deler av teksten som er viktige i en gitt kontekst.

Ved språkbearbeiding bruker disse modellene statistiske metoder for å forutsi hvilket ord som sannsynligvis kommer neste, eller hvilken setning som mest sannsynlig følger i en tekst. De kan forstå kontekst over lange tekststykker og dermed generere tekster som ikke bare er grammatisk korrekte, men også innholdsmessig sammenhengende og relevante.

Ved bruk av en språkmodell for eksempel i en chatbot eller tekstgenerator, blir modellen gitt visse prompts eller innledende data og basert på denne inputen genererer modellen tekst som logisk følger av den gitte konteksten. Målet med disse modellene er å produsere tekst som ser så menneskelig ut som mulig, både når det gjelder innhold og stil.

Tekst-til-bilde-modeller

Tekst-til-bilde-modeller er AI-systemer som er i stand til å generere visuelle representasjoner fra skriftlige beskrivende tekster, som fotografier, illustrasjoner eller andre typer billedmateriale. Disse modellene bruker avanserte nevrale nettverk, og mer spesifikt generative adversarial networks (GAN-er) eller varianter av disse som diffusion-modeller.

Prosessen begynner med et tekstlig beskrivelse inntatt av en bruker. Modellen vurderer teksten og prøver å forstå betydningen og konteksten av den. Deretter genererer modellen bilder som samsvarer med tekstbeskrivelsen, ved hjelp av det den har lært under treningen, hvor den trenes på enorme datasett av tekst-bilde-par.

Under treningen lærer modellen assosiasjoner mellom tekstbeskrivelser og visuelle kjennetegn. For eksempel, hvis modellen gjentatte ganger ser ordkombinasjonen "en gul sol over et blått hav" sammen med bilder som illustrerer dette scenariet, lærer den å gjenkjenne og reprodusere disse elementene i fremtidige bildeproduksjoner.

Resultatet er ofte overraskende nøyaktige og detaljerte bilder som passer til den inntatte tekstbeskrivelsen. Disse modellene blir stadig mer raffinerte og er i stand til å gjengi komplekse scenarier med flere objekter og abstrakte konsepter. De brukes i et bredt spekter av applikasjoner, inkludert kunstnerisk skapelse, spillutvikling, virtuell virkelighet og mer.

AI-Public åpner modeller

Det er viktig å innse at AI-Public åpner ulike AI-modeller som tilbys av store teknologiselskaper via et API. En API, eller Application Programming Interface, er et sett regler og definisjoner som gjør at programvare kan kommunisere med hverandre. Den fungerer som en slags 'språk' som programmene forstår for å utveksle informasjon og kalle funksjoner til hverandre. AI-Public har ikke egne språkmodeller eller tekst-til-bilde-modeller.

Vi er ikke ansvarlige for resultatene fra de ulike modellene. Vi har imidlertid oppmerksomt utvalgt de beste og mest interessante modellene for bedrifter.

Prosedyre for behandling

Følgende prosedyre følges for å generere et svar:

  • Brukeren lager en prompt.
  • Frontend- webapplikasjonen kobler dette til den aktive chatten og legger til en chatmelding med status "Initialisere".
  • På AI-Publics servere utløses en funksjon ved å legge til en chatmelding.
  • Statusen til chatmeldingen settes til "Behandler".
  • Ved utvalg av chat med dokumenter sender serveren først en forespørsel til Firestore vektor-database for å velge tekstene fra dokumentene.
  • Deretter sender serveren forespørselen via en API-kobling til den valgte språkmodellen.
  • Hvis innstillingen Strøm er aktivert, lagrer vi meldingen etter hver 10 mottatte chunk og etter hver 25 chunks etter mottak av 100 chunks.
  • Så snart hele svaret er mottatt, settes statusen til "Ferdig".
  • Frontend-applikasjonen oppdateres ** ved hver databaseoppdatering**.
  • Ved oppdagede feil settes statusen til "Feil" og en feilmelding vises.

Vi sender ingen personopplysninger sammen med hver API-forespørsel. Imidlertid kan brukeren ha inkludert personopplysninger i prompten eller i de opplastede dokumentene.